How to create effective educational email paths that build user competence and confidence with new features over time.

As product teams introduce new features, users benefit most when education arrives in a thoughtful, sustained sequence rather than a single sprint. An effective educational path begins with a clear mapping of user goals to the feature set, then translates that map into a series of email moments aligned with real workflows. Each touchpoint should deliver a tangible outcome—how to complete a task, how to recover from a common mistake, or how to compare two options within the feature. By framing messages around outcomes rather than features alone, you reduce friction and create momentum that carries users forward with measurable confidence.
The first phase focuses on awareness and relevance. Start with a welcome note that confirms the user’s context and the problem the new feature solves for them. Follow with micro-lessons that demonstrate a single action, accompanied by a quick before-and-after example. Keep language concrete, avoid jargon, and provide a link to a short, under-two-minute walkthrough. This phase should feel purposeful, not promotional, and should invite users to try the feature in a controlled, low-stakes environment. Acknowledge potential barriers and promise simple, practical guidance to overcome them.
Build progressive practice into every email interaction.
In the middle stages, progress becomes personal. Segmentation matters: tailor messages by user role, usage level, and recent activity with the feature. Create a cadence that nudges users from passive reading to active practice, such as a guided task or an optional sandbox scenario. Include short, task-focused videos or GIFs that illustrate exact steps. Pair these with inline tips or micro-checklists to avoid cognitive overload. The objective is to foster incremental mastery—small wins that accumulate into confidence—so users feel capable of applying new tools in their everyday work.

To deepen understanding, intersperse case-based content that mirrors real-world contexts. Share short stories of how peers in similar industries solved a common problem with the feature. Immediately follow with a practical exercise, asking recipients to replicate the outcome on their own data or environment. This approach makes learning transferable and concrete, not theoretical. Track engagement metrics such as completion rates, time-to-success, and feature reusage, then adapt the path accordingly. When users see themselves succeeding, motivation grows, and commitment to exploring further features strengthens.
Use storytelling and practice to reinforce long-term competence.
The next stage emphasizes confidence and autonomy. Encourage self-guided exploration by offering a “practice mode” or a safe test environment embedded within the product. Complement this with email prompts that invite users to try a specific workflow, then report back with a quick reflection. Use supportive language that normalizes initial errors as part of learning. Celebrate small achievements with badges, notes, or visible progress indicators. By highlighting progress rather than perfection, you reinforce a growth mindset and reduce resistance to experimentation.

Provide practical, bite-sized checklists that users can implement within minutes. Each item should have a concrete, measurable result, a suggested time commitment, and a clear next step. Include troubleshooting tips for common missteps, plus a link to a short video showing the correct approach. This format makes learning actionable and repeatable, so users can build competence without feeling overwhelmed. Regularly refresh these checklists as the feature evolves, ensuring relevance and continued motivation to practice.
Integrate feedback loops and evergreen updates for lasting impact.
As adoption accelerates, your emails should reinforce long-term competence with pattern recognition. Demonstrate how to combine the new feature with existing workflows to unlock superior outcomes. Provide comparative scenarios—before using the feature, after implementing it—to illustrate tangible benefits. Encourage users to document their own best practices in a shared space, such as a community forum or knowledge base. Public recognition for helpful tips creates peer-driven learning that sustains momentum. The combination of narrative context and practical replication helps embed the feature into daily routines.
Equally important is feedback that closes the learning loop. Invite users to rate clarity, ease of use, and impact after each learning moment. Use brief, actionable surveys and follow up with tailored tips to address any gaps. Analyze qualitative signals like questions asked in support chats or forum threads to identify recurring friction points. Close the loop by updating the educational path to reflect real user needs, turning feedback into higher-value guidance that remains evergreen across feature iterations.

Maintain clarity, relevance, and supportive pacing across all messages.
The final phase centers on empowerment and advocacy. Users who reach competence are more likely to become champions—sharing tips with colleagues, recommending the feature, and contributing to best-practice resources. The email path should include occasional “success stories” from real users, along with advanced tips that push seasoned practitioners to explore underutilized capabilities. Encourage participation in webinars or office hours, reinforcing a community around learning. Ensure that at every touchpoint, the promise of ongoing support is clear, so users feel they are never left to guesswork.
To sustain momentum, automate a long-tail cadence that revisits older content tied to new feature updates. Repackage successful lessons into refreshers, offer quick audits, and provide personalized recommendations based on usage data. Automations should be transparent—explain why the message is arriving and how to act on it. By maintaining a steady stream of relevant, actionable guidance, you help users build lasting competence and confidence, even as product capabilities continue to evolve.
Throughout the education path, tone is critical. Aim for a calm, supportive voice that respects user time and avoids bragging or hype. Use precise verbs to describe actions, and replace abstract promises with observable outcomes. Visuals—such as annotated screenshots or brief clips—can complement text without overwhelming the reader. Clear CTAs that specify exact next steps reduce friction and increase completion rates. When users finish a module, acknowledge the achievement and point to the next logical learning moment in the path, creating a natural continuum.
Finally, measure and optimize with intention. Establish key metrics: time-to-first-success, completion rate, reactivation after dormancy, and feature uptake post-education. Conduct periodic experiments to refine sequence length, messaging, and content formats. Use cohort insights to tailor pathways to varying maturity levels across your audience. Communicate results transparently to stakeholders and invite cross-functional input. With disciplined analysis and iterative improvement, an educational email path becomes a durable engine for competence, confidence, and sustained feature adoption.
